Philip Spencer is a Vice President at Tritium Partners, responsible for sourcing and executing new investments and monitoring Tritium’s portfolio companies.
Prior to rejoining the firm as a Vice President, Philip spent three years as an Associate at Tritium, evaluating investment opportunities and working with portfolio companies to drive growth, before leaving to pursue his MBA.
Philip started his career at Raymond James & Associates, where he spent two years as an Investment Banking Analyst, advising clients on mergers & acquisitions, capital markets and private placement transactions.
Philip received an MBA from the Kellogg School of Management at Northwestern University and a BBA in Finance and Business Fellows with honors from Baylor University.

Founded in 2013, Tritium Partners is a private equity firm focused on technology and services companies with exceptional growth potential. Tritium’s approach emphasizes creating long-term value through both strategic growth plans and acquisitions. They actively partner with talented founders and executives to build market-leading companies through high-growth initiatives, while maintaining capital efficiency.
